Replacing a garage door lock might seem overwhelming, however with the right tools and techniques, it can be a manageable DIY job. Follow the steps below:
Tools Required: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ips)Replacement lockKey (if needed for your new lock type)Lubricant (for maintaining the new lock)Safety safety glassesReplacement Steps:
Assess the Current Lock: Identify whether the lock is functioning or completely broken. This will inform your replacement options.
Collect Necessary Tools: Before starting, ensure you have all the tools at hand.
Remove the Old Lock:
Open the garage door.Find the screws holding the lock in location, normally noticeable from inside the garage.Loosen the fasteners with the screwdriver and carefully take out the lock mechanism.
Prepare the New Lock:
Follow the producer's instructions for your new lock, making sure all parts are intact.Evaluate the new lock mechanism to guarantee it works correctly before installation.
Install the New Lock:
Align the new lock in the very same position as the old one.Secure it in location utilizing the screws. Tighten them adequately, but take care not to overtighten, which can damage the material.
Check the New Lock: After installation, test the lock several times to ensure smooth operation. Inspect both locking and unlocking functions.
Apply Lubricant: To boost the function and durability of the lock, apply a percentage of lube to the locking mechanism.
Maintain the Lock: Set up a regular maintenance regimen for your garage door lock.
Maintenance Tips for Garage Door Locks
To make sure the longevity of your new garage pocket door lock replacement lock and keep security, consider these maintenance ideas:
Regular Lubrication: Perform lubrication of the lock at least once a year. Look for Rust: Inspect for indications of rust or deterioration, especially in wet climates. Resolve any concerns immediately.Test Security Features: If you installed an electronic door locks or smart lock, guarantee that the battery is functioning and system updates are carried out.Tidy Mechanisms: Regularly clean locks with a damp fabric and eliminate particles or dirt that may impede proper performance.Consider Professional Help: For upkeep of more complex locks, such as smart locks, consider hiring an expert for assessments.FAQs
